The Reason for Canada’s Temporary Resident Cap
Using the rationale of escalating concerns about housing, infrastructure and inflation, Canada has imposed its first cap on temporary immigration. The goal is to keep the percentage of non-permanent residents in the population from about 7% down to 5% in the next three years. In addition to its alternative permanent resident targets, this new method means the process of approving visas will also be more rigorous and exclusive.
What Is Different For Visitor Visa Applicants?
End of Automatic 10-Year Multiple Entry Visas.
Historically, there were many applicants who were automatically granted a multiple-entry visitor visa, who could receive a visa valid for up to 10 years. This is no longer the case. Now, immigration officers assess each application individually, often granting a single entry or shorter term based on an analysis of the applicant’s profile.

In 2025, immigration authorities will significantly enhance their power to cancel visitor visas or electronic travel authorizations at border entry points if they suspect an applicant did not meet eligibility criteria or notice discrepancies.
Increasing Refusal Rates
In recent years, a higher number of visitor visas have been refused, with about 50 % of temporary resident applications being denied overall.
Even applicants from countries that have a high percentage of visa issuance and high level refusal rates like you’ll notice applications from India, will receive increased scrutiny when presenting for a visitor visa application.
Even visitors without credible substantiation of stable employment, home ownership or family connections obtain short term visas or rejections.

Approaches to Improve Your Visitor Visa Chances
If you’ve been wondering about how to get a travel visa to Canada in all of this uncertainty, here are a few ways to enhance your application:
Demonstrate Strong Ties to Your Home Country
Having evidence of stable employment, having ownership to property, or having family obligations make the immigration officials believe you plan on going back after your visit.
Provide Clear Financial Evidence
Provide proof of finances that you have enough money to cover your whole stay whether through personal funds, sponsorship letters, or support from your employer. This take away any worries about unauthorized employment or overstaying your visit.
Clearly State Your Purpose for Visiting
If you’re visiting family, attending a conference, or travelling for leisure, supply itineraries of your trip, in addition to any invitation letters from relatives or organisations, and evidence of accommodation for your visit.
Apply for Your visa as early as possible
Processing times are taking longer due to the increase in applications as well as increased scrutiny of applications. Applying as early as you can means you are less likely to be stressed at the last minute and have problems travelling.
Take advantage of your travel history
Having a history of complying with travel regulations, especially to countries such as Canada or the United States can show that you are a reliable traveller.
